Job Description
Python Developer designs, develops, and maintains scalable applications, builds APIs, automates processes, optimizes performance, collaborates with teams, and delivers secure, high-quality software solutions using Python technologies.
Key Responsibilities
- Develop and maintain web applications using Python and React.js.
- Collaborate with cross-functional teams to define application requirements.
- Ensure application performance, scalability, and security best practices.
- Write clean, maintainable, and efficient code following coding standards.
- Troubleshoot and debug applications to optimize performance.
- Participate in code reviews to maintain code quality.
- Stay updated with emerging technologies and industry trends.
- Contribute to all phases of the development lifecycle.
Skill & Experience
- Proficiency in Python and React.js for full-stack development.
- Strong understanding of RESTful APIs and web services integration.
- Experience with databases like MySQL, PostgreSQL, or MongoDB.
- Familiarity with version control systems, preferably Git.
- Knowledge of Agile methodologies and DevOps practices.
- Excellent problem-solving skills and attention to detail.
Note: Salary depends on experience and skills and is paid in local currency.